8 Dec 2016 | Abstract: | We performed ultrafast degenerate pump-probe spectroscopy on monolayer WSe2
near its exciton resonance. The observed differential reflectance signals
exhibit signatures of strong many-body interactions including the
exciton-exciton interaction and free carrier induced band gap renormalization.
The exciton-exciton interaction results in a resonance blue shift which lasts
for the exciton lifetime (several ps), while the band gap renormalization
manifests as a resonance red shift with several tens ps lifetime. Our model
based on the many-body interactions for the nonlinear optical susceptibility
fits well the experimental observations. The power dependence of the spectra
shows that with the increase of pump power, the exciton population increases
linearly and then saturates, while the free carrier density increases
superlinearly, implying that exciton Auger recombination could be the origin of
these free carriers. Our model demonstrates a simple but efficient method for
quantitatively analyzing the spectra, and indicates the important role of
Coulomb interactions in nonlinear optical responses of such 2D materials. | Source: | arXiv, 1612.2714 | Services: | Forum | Review | PDF | Favorites |
